30 seconds recharge on ability to host locally.
This commit is contained in:
parent
21d255fcd1
commit
bb8b1d60f9
@ -4,6 +4,7 @@ import org.bukkit.entity.Player;
|
||||
|
||||
import mineplex.core.command.CommandBase;
|
||||
import mineplex.core.common.Rank;
|
||||
import mineplex.core.recharge.Recharge;
|
||||
|
||||
public class HostServerCommand extends CommandBase<PersonalServerManager>
|
||||
{
|
||||
@ -15,6 +16,9 @@ public class HostServerCommand extends CommandBase<PersonalServerManager>
|
||||
@Override
|
||||
public void Execute(Player caller, String[] args)
|
||||
{
|
||||
if (!Recharge.Instance.use(caller, "Host Server", 30000, true, true))
|
||||
return;
|
||||
|
||||
Plugin.hostServer(caller, caller.getName());
|
||||
}
|
||||
}
|
||||
|
@ -14,6 +14,7 @@ import mineplex.core.account.CoreClientManager;
|
||||
import mineplex.core.common.util.C;
|
||||
import mineplex.core.common.util.F;
|
||||
import mineplex.core.itemstack.ItemStackFactory;
|
||||
import mineplex.core.recharge.Recharge;
|
||||
import mineplex.serverdata.Region;
|
||||
import mineplex.serverdata.ServerGroup;
|
||||
import mineplex.serverdata.ServerManager;
|
||||
@ -57,6 +58,9 @@ public class PersonalServerManager extends MiniPlugin
|
||||
{
|
||||
if (_interfaceItem.equals(event.getPlayer().getItemInHand()))
|
||||
{
|
||||
if (!Recharge.Instance.use(event.getPlayer(), "Host Server", 30000, true, true))
|
||||
return;
|
||||
|
||||
hostServer(event.getPlayer(), event.getPlayer().getName());
|
||||
}
|
||||
}
|
||||
@ -84,7 +88,7 @@ public class PersonalServerManager extends MiniPlugin
|
||||
|
||||
public void hostServer(Player player, String serverName)
|
||||
{
|
||||
createGroup(player, serverName, 24, 24, "Smash");
|
||||
createGroup(player, serverName, 12, 24, "Smash");
|
||||
}
|
||||
|
||||
private void createGroup(final Player host, final String serverName, int minPlayers, int maxPlayers, String games)
|
||||
|
Loading…
Reference in New Issue
Block a user